Technical Problem

Existing automotive connecting rod assemblies lack limiting structures during long-term use, which makes the connecting rod cover and connecting rod body prone to misalignment, affecting the stability and lifespan of the transmission operation.

Method used

A limiting gasket is set between the connecting rod cap and the connecting rod body, and the positioning is limited by the embedded positioning port structure of the first positioning plate and the second positioning plate. At the same time, an oil distribution groove and an oil injection port are set in the connecting rod body to realize the distribution lubrication of lubricating oil.

Benefits of technology

It improves the connection stability and smoothness between the connecting rod body and the connecting rod cap, enhances the stability of the vehicle transmission, and improves wear resistance and service life during use through comprehensive lubrication.

Abstract

本实用新型提供一种汽车连杆组件。所述汽车连杆组件,包括杆身,所述杆身的顶端拆卸设置有连杆小头,所述杆身的底端设置有连杆体,所述连杆体的底部拆卸设置有连杆盖,所述连杆体与所述连杆盖之间设置有限位垫片,所述限位垫片的上表面固定连接有第一定位板,所述连杆体的底部开设有与所述第一定位板适配的第一定位口。本实用新型提供的汽车连杆组件,通过连杆盖与连杆体之间连接后,限位垫片设置于连杆盖与连杆体之间,利用第一定位板嵌入第一定位口的内部与第二定位板嵌入第二定位口的内部后,即可对连杆体与连杆盖之间,进而对连杆体与连杆盖之间进行定位限制,提高连杆体与连杆盖连接后的侧面平整性,进而利于汽车传动工作使用。

Claims

1. An automotive linkage assembly comprising a strut (1) characterised in that: A connecting rod small end (2) is detachably provided at the top of the rod body (1), a connecting rod body (3) is provided at the bottom of the rod body (1), a connecting rod cover (4) is detachably provided at the bottom of the connecting rod body (3), a limiting gasket (15) is provided between the connecting rod body (3) and the connecting rod cover (4), a first positioning plate (8) is fixedly connected to the upper surface of the limiting gasket (15), a first positioning port (9) adapted to the first positioning plate (8) is opened at the bottom of the connecting rod body (3), a second positioning plate (16) is fixedly connected to the lower surface of the limiting gasket (15), a second positioning port (17) adapted to the second positioning plate (16) is opened at the top of the connecting rod cover (4), and an oil distribution groove (13) is opened on the inner wall surface of both the connecting rod body (3) and the connecting rod cover (4).

2. The automotive link assembly of claim 1, wherein, The bottom of the connecting rod cover (4) is provided with countersunk holes (5) at both ends, and a first bolt (6) is provided on the countersunk hole (5). The limiting washer (15) and the top of the connecting rod body (3) are provided with through holes (7) that are adapted to the first bolt (6). The top end of the first bolt (6) passes through the interior of the corresponding through hole (7) and is provided with a first nut (10).

3. The automotive link assembly of claim 2, wherein, An anti-loosening washer (11) is fitted on the top of the surface of the first bolt (6) between the first nut (10) and the top of the connecting rod body (3).

4. The automotive link assembly of claim 1, wherein, Both ends of the top of the connecting rod body (3) are provided with oil inlets (12) that communicate with the inside of the oil distribution groove (13).

5. The automotive link assembly of claim 1, wherein, Both ends of the top of the inner wall of the connecting rod body (3) are provided with oil distribution ports (14) that communicate with the inside of the oil distribution groove (13).

6. The automotive link assembly of claim 1, wherein, A positioning block (18) is fixedly connected to the front side of the top end of the rod body (1), and a positioning slot (19) adapted to the positioning block (18) is opened at the bottom of the front side of the small end (2) of the connecting rod.

7. The automotive link assembly of claim 1, wherein, A connecting block (20) is fixedly connected to the bottom of the rear side of the small end (2) of the connecting rod. Several second bolts (21) are provided on the connecting block (20). Several through holes adapted to the second bolts (21) are opened on the rod body (1). The front end of the second bolt (21) passes through the interior of the through hole and is threadedly connected to a second nut (22).
